What’s special about mrs.maudies cake in to kill a mockingbird

English
1 answer:
Illusion [34]3 years ago
3 0

Answer:

ms.maudie usually makes three small cakes for jem, scout, and dill. After the trial, she makes two small cakes for Scout and Dill and cuts jem a piece from the adult cake, symbolizing that he is growing up.

The etymology of a word represents its _____. grammar, part of speech, history, context.
kherson [118]
The answer is history. The etymology of a word represents its history. Etymology studies the origin of the words which means it is the study of the words' histories. It also studies how the words have changed throughout years after years.
